The most relevant benefit of exercise to cardiovascular health from the provided responses is:
**It improves the flow of oxygen to the cells in your body.**
Regular exercise strengthens the heart, improves circulation, and enhances the efficiency of the cardiovascular system, which in turn helps deliver oxygen more effectively throughout the body.
